Translation of the UI is currently split into 3 preferences: interface, tooltips, and new data. The distinction between interface and tooltips is currently unclear as tooltips also include a lot of messages not displayed in the actual tooltips on mouse hover. These include reports to the Info Editor, information in editor headers and footers, and statuses in panels. In order to limit the use of `TIP_()` to actual tooltips, this commit introduces a new preference for this extra information: "Reports". New translation macros are introduced: `RPT_()` and `CTX_RPT_()`, as well as their equivalent for the Python API, `pgettext_rpt_()`, to be imported as `rpt_()`. Blender Dev Tools ################# This repository is intended for miscellaneous tools, utilities, configurations and anything that helps with Blender development, but aren't directly related to building Blender. Some of the tools included may be used stand-alone, others expect Blenders source code to be available. Usage ===== While this is a stand-alone repository, some of the scripts which access Blenders source code assume this repository will be located at ``tools`` within Blenders source code repository. At some point this may be included as a submodule. Some tools also rely on the ``blender`` binary, this is assumed to be located at: ``../../blender.bin``. *The root directory of Blender's git repository* Categories ========== Check Source ------------ Any tools for scanning source files to report issues with code, style, conventions, deprecated features etc. Config ------ Configuration for 3rd party applications (IDE's, code-analysis, debugging tools... etc). Git --- Scripts and utilities for working with git. Utils ----- Programs (scripts) to help with development (currently for converting formats, creating mouse cursor, updating themes).
